Output 50bb99209135860fe53a4265d229c7ecfd7ff388929dfba042160dfc8f55d1a7:5

value
7200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e24a39b7846b82e393be955c7f2baa1fb02e858 OP_EQUAL
address
3G7CaagsYc7CGKboPqTAsVoqkGq57K8c7G
transaction
50bb99209135860fe53a4265d229c7ecfd7ff388929dfba042160dfc8f55d1a7
spent
true